Apache Atlas是什么意思
分类: Apache学习 发布时间: 2025-02-02 14:27:31
Apache Atlas是Hadoop社区为解决Hadoop生态系统的元数据治理问题而产生的开源项目。它是Apache基金会的孵化项目,专为Hadoop生态圈设计的数据治理和元数据框架(Data Governance and Metadata framework)。Apache Atlas为Hado...
在当今这个数据为王的时代,如何高效地管理和利用数据资产已成为企业竞争力的关键。而Apache Atlas,作为一款开源的数据治理和元数据管理工具,正逐渐成为众多企业的首选。
Apache Atlas是Hadoop社区为解决Hadoop生态系统的元数据治理问题而产生的开源项目。它是Apache基金会的孵化项目,专为Hadoop生态圈设计的数据治理和元数据框架(Data Governance and Metadata framework)。Apache Atlas为Hadoop的元数据治理提供了包括数据分类、集中策略引擎、数据血缘、安全和生命周期管理在内的核心能力。这些功能使得企业能够有效地管理和利用其数据资产,提高数据质量和安全性。
Apache Atlas的核心特性包括:
- 数据分类:为元数据导入或定义业务导向的分类注释,导出元数据到第三方系统。
- 集中审计:捕获所有应用、过程以及与数据交互的安全访问信息。
- 搜索与血缘:提供预定义的导航路径探索数据分类及审计信息,对数据集血缘关系的可视化浏览。
- 安全与策略引擎:基于数据分类模式、属性及角色的运行时合理合规策略,与Apache Ranger数据安全框架集成实现访问控制和数据屏蔽等功能。
此外,Apache Atlas还具备出色的集成与扩展性。它不仅能与Hadoop生态系统中的其他组件(如Hive、Sqoop、Storm等)进行集成,还能与企业级软件(如企业数据仓库、商业智能工具等)无缝对接。这种强大的集成能力使得企业能够根据自身需求进行定制开发,添加新的功能模块或集成其他数据源。
综上所述,Apache Atlas作为一款功能强大、灵活可扩展的数据治理工具,正成为越来越多企业的选择。它不仅能够帮助企业高效地管理和利用数据资产,还能提升数据质量和安全性,为企业的数据驱动决策提供有力支持。